Book Synopsis The Girl Who Loved to Sing by : Lavanya Karthik

Book excerpt: Before Teejan Bai became a world-renowned singer, she was a little girl who had to fight for her freedom to sing. A delightfully illustrated short biography that will inspire young readers.
